About Josephine, Texas

Josephine is a locality in Collin County, Texas, United States. It has a population of approximately 2,119. The population density is 452.8 people per km². Josephine is located at 33.0612°N, 96.3072°W. It observes the Central Time (America/Chicago) timezone. Josephine is an incorporated locality. ZIP codes: 75164, 75173.
